带有 Debian 9 的双启动系统上的 Windows 10 无法正常关机

带有 Debian 9 的双启动系统上的 Windows 10 无法正常关机

几天前,我在我的系统上安装了 Windows 10 和 Debian 9 Stretch 作为双启动。一切顺利,我能够毫无问题地启动两个系统。

两个系统(几乎)都运行完美——除了 Windows。我注意到我无法关闭 Windows。每次我通过 Windows 键 -> Powersymbole -> 关机选择“关机”时,Windows 都会关闭屏幕——这就是所发生的一切。如果有更新要安装,则会出现不同的行为:Windows 进入其“更新屏幕”,并在安装更新后关闭。如果您再次启动计算机并选择 Windows 进行启动,Windows 会告知更新未成功,它将尝试恢复最新的保存点。完成该步骤后,情况仍然相同:Windows 无法关机,只有屏幕关闭。

我无法解释这一点,因为 Debian 9 运行完美。

我猜问题出在我安装两个系统的方式上。我是这样做的:

  • 我将硬盘分成两个大小相同的分区
  • 首先,我在分区 1 上安装了 Windows
  • 其次,我在分区 2 上安装了 Debian 9,并将 Grub 安装到主记录中
  • 我启动了两个系统并设置了系统以在它们上运行

我猜测错误就出在这些步骤上,但正如我所说,我不确定。

有什么方法可以修复这个错误吗?

提前非常感谢您。

答案1

视窗将系统状态保存到硬盘以加快启动速度,不仅仅是当休眠已启用,但如果快速启动或设置了“混合关机”。这些文件,例如休眠文件,可能会在双启动时导致问题,因此请禁用快速启动在里面电源选项对话。 休眠可以从 CMD 提示符或批处理文件(以管理员身份执行)启用或禁用,如果您经常使用该功能但仍想启动到 Linux,这可能会很方便:

powercfg-h关闭

为了确保完全关闭而不是混合关闭,可以使用以下命令:

关机/s/t 0

这两个命令可以合并为一个批处理文件。

相关内容